This is a small test that will check for the ability to parse
both legacy and modern options for rbd.

The way the test is set up is for failure to occur, but without
having to wait to timeout on a non-existent rbd server.  The error
messages in the success path show that the arguments were parsed.

The failure behavior prior to the patch series that has this test, is
qemu-img complaining about mandatory options (e.g. 'pool') not being
provided.
